Annual industrial robot shipments will reach more than 760k units in 2030
TodayThe industrial robot industry saw 5.1% growth in 2025, following a contraction of -2% in 2024, Interact Analysis reports. The market is now forecast to record steady growth out to 2030, at an average annual rate of 6.7%, rising from 549,555 units in 2025 to 761,303 units in 2030.
